Deep Dive
1. Purpose & Narrative
PNUT was created as a tribute to a real pet squirrel named Peanut, whose story of rescue and subsequent euthanization by authorities went viral in 2024. This emotional narrative sparked the #JusticeForPeanut campaign, transforming the token into a symbol of internet meme culture and social activism. Its core purpose is not to solve a technical problem but to immortalize this story on the blockchain, creating a community around shared sentiment.
2. Tokenomics & Utility
The token has a fixed supply of 1 billion coins, minted on October 31, 2024, with nearly all tokens in circulation. According to a Bitstamp document, PNUT has no utility, rights, or governance structure. It is not backed by any company or foundation and cannot be exchanged for goods or services. Its price is determined purely by market supply and demand, making it a highly speculative asset.
3. Ecosystem & Drivers
PNUT operates entirely within the Solana ecosystem, benefiting from its low transaction fees and high speed for rapid trading. Its value is acutely sensitive to social media trends and celebrity mentions, most notably from figures like Elon Musk, whose tweets have triggered sharp price rallies. The project's longevity depends on sustained community engagement and viral attention rather than technological development.
